[0001] The utility model belongs to the technical field of vehicle accessories and relates to a vehicle throttle valve. Background Art

[0002] The throttle body assembly is part of the engine's intake system, controlling intake air volume under various engine conditions. Depending on the application, it may also integrate a throttle position sensor, intake air temperature sensor, intake air pressure sensor, and idle belt control valve. For motorcycles, due to the varying space and structure of the throttle body assembly, a custom throttle body assembly often needs to be developed specifically for that particular model. Failure to do so can impact the vehicle's performance, quality, and cost. Existing throttle bodies feature an integrated throttle body design, making installation, cleaning, and maintenance complex, making them difficult to meet user requirements. Summary of the Invention

[0003] The purpose of the utility model is to provide a throttle valve that is easy to assemble and maintain in order to solve the above problems in the prior art.

[0004] The purpose of the utility model can be achieved through the following technical solutions: A vehicle throttle valve, comprising a valve body and a throttle body arranged on the valve body and movably cooperated with the valve body, characterized in that the valve body is provided with a mounting unit connected to the valve body and for mounting the throttle body at the throttle body, the valve body is provided with a through hole on the outer peripheral wall at the throttle body, which penetrates the valve body and is convenient for loading and unloading the mounting unit, the valve body is provided with a protrusion axially outwardly protruding on the outer periphery of the through hole and used to protect the mounting unit, and the protrusion is provided with a sealing unit connected to the valve body and used to seal the protrusion.

[0005] In the above-mentioned vehicle throttle valve, the throttle body is composed of a main rod and two door plates which are respectively arranged on both sides of the main rod and are integrally provided with the main rod.

[0006] In the above-mentioned vehicle throttle valve, two limit blocks connected to the valve body and used to limit the position of the throttle body are provided on the inner wall of the valve body located at the throttle body.

[0007] In the above-mentioned vehicle throttle valve, the installation unit is a mounting shaft, and the main rod in the throttle body is provided with a mounting hole for the mounting shaft to be inserted and installed, and the main rod and the mounting shaft are connected by a number of studs, and the two ends of the mounting shaft are respectively extended into the corresponding raised parts through the main rod.

[0008] In the above-mentioned vehicle throttle valve, the sealing unit is a sealing plug, and the sealing plug is provided with a bent and elastic elastic folded edge on the outer peripheral wall at the inner end. The inner wall of the above-mentioned raised portion is arranged in a multi-step structure, and the vertical cross-section of the elastic folded edge is arranged in two symmetrically arranged L-shaped structures, and the sealing plug is provided with an axially outwardly protruding convex ring portion on the inner end face of the elastic folded edge, and the outer edge of the convex ring portion is provided with a rounded corner.

[0009] In the above-mentioned vehicle throttle valve, the sealing plug is provided with an annular ring connected to the sealing plug and fitted with the elastic folded edge, and the outer end surface of the sealing plug is provided with a pull ring connected to the sealing plug.

[0010] In the above-mentioned vehicle throttle valve, a movable ring connected to the mounting shaft is sleeved on the end surface of the mounting shaft at the raised portion, and a sealing ring block sleeved on the mounting shaft and used to enhance sealing is provided between the movable ring and the valve body.
